    2. Digital Engineering for Improving Lifetime Value in the Mobility Field

    The automotive industry has been undergoing significant transformation in recent years, and the integrated value of vehicle lifetime value (LTV) and in-car*1 and out-car*2 elements has become ever more important. Hitachi has leveraged the power of user experience design and chip-to-cloud digital engineering including GlobalLogic’s capabilities to create new values across vehicles’ entire lifecycles from development and manufacture, to sales, ownership, and maintenance. The specific details are as follows.

    1. Development and manufacturing
      Hitachi enables next-gen software defined vehicle (SDV) development leveraging its rich SDV-related software development track record and engineering talents at a global scale.
    2. Vehicle sales: Hitachi closely collaborates with clients to create new sales experiences and sales models leveraging its experiences working with world-leading retailers and cutting-edge partner solutions.
    3. Ownership: Hitachi closely collaborates with clients to create new personalized services leveraging case studies and knowhow in new service incubation and data utilization projects across diverse industries including retail, finance and media.
    4. Maintenance: Hitachi enables more efficient maintenance operation and create value added services leveraging its advanced three-demensional (3D) modeling and data analytics technologies.

    3. Expansion of DX-applied Operations Using Generative AI

    The launch of ChatGPT* in 2022 and similar services focused attention on generative AI, and in 2023, many companies introduced platforms and trialed systems that leveraged their internal data. Then in 2024, generative AI started to be applied in actual work, and its scope of operations was expanded from previous indirect work such as document search and summary to supporting frontline workers in core operations and areas facing severe human capital shortages.

    In this context, Hitachi announced its “Generative AI utilization professional service powered by Lumada” in July 2024. This service expands the operations in which DX can be applied by utilizing digital engineering*1.

    The service addresses the following customer problems, (1) customers do not know the next step after introducing the platform, (2) customers want to leverage internal documents, but they are difficult to use without increasing their accuracy, and (3) utilization is limited except for certain employees. To overcome these challenges, the service supports the full-scale introduction of generative AI, and provides technical support and training of human capital.

    As of July 2024, retrieval augmented generation (RAG) was typically being used as the technology for utilizing internal data. However in the future, as described in the August press release*2, the combined use and compartmentalization of industry-specific large language models (LLM) should enable more advanced inference and expand the range of applications in operations.

    5. Customer Co-creation Approach as a Factor in Successful Digital Utilization

    The speed of change has accelerated in modern society, and industrial structures are also shifting rapidly, giving rise to an age where there are no correct answers. The "Agile approach" is a project management technique that seeks to address these changes. Unlike the conventional waterfall model, this technique does not stick to a predetermined plan, but rather drives forward the project by responding flexibly to changes and updating requirements and specifications along the way. The key to this technique is to clarify the needs and dissatisfactions of the customer, but real feedback cannot be obtained just by conducting an interview. This is because end users do not understand what they want until they actually try using a service for the first time.

    An important factor in successful digital utilization is to have the mindset of "Fail Fast & Learn Quickly." Hitachi Consulting Co., Ltd. takes a user-centric approach throughout the lifecycle of a project, from planning to verification, development, and operation. In this way, feedback from customers and stakeholders is reflected promptly in requirements and specifications, resulting in a successful project that creates new value.

    6. Total Offering of IT Modernization Utilizing Generative AI

    In addition to digital transformation (DX) that creates value, corporate growth requires digitalization that includes the modernization of existing systems, such as core systems that must function correctly.

    Hitachi has a long track record of developing and operating mission critical systems, as well as upstream experience of conducting strategic planning and execution in parallel from a customer perspective, while GlobalLogic has supported numerous digital transformations on a global scale. Hitachi will combine these results with generative AI and other modern technologies to deploy a total offering that delivers IT modernization both in Japan and across global markets.

    This offering covers the entire process for IT modernization from strategic planning to execution. The strengthening of this process by generative AI enables the customer to start at any point, depending on the customer's situation. The offering helps customers achieve sustainable growth by storing and utilizing transaction logs and business logs, visualizing current conditions through advanced process mining, creating and executing a road map that takes the priorities of customers into account, and then receiving the corresponding feedback.
